expand: Get rid of resolve_macro_path
It was used to choose whether to apply derive markers like `#[rustc_copy_clone_marker]` or not, but it was called before all the data required for resolution is available, so it could work incorrectly in some corner cases (like user-defined derives name `Copy` or `Eq`). Delay the decision about markers until the proper resolution results are available instead.
